Michaela Zee “Harry Potter” actor Miriam Margolyes is concerned about adult fans of the beloved franchise. “They should be over that by now,” Margolyes said in a recent interview with New Zealand’s 1News. “You know, I mean, it was 25 years ago, and it’s for children.
I think it’s for children.” Margolyes played Professor Pomona Sprout, who taught herbology at Hogwarts and was head of the Hufflepuff House.
She appeared in 2002’s “Harry Potter and the Chamber of Secrets” and 2011’s “Harry Potter and the Deathly Hallows – Part 2.” “They get stuck in it,” Margolyes said. “I do Cameos, and people say, ‘Oh, we’re having a “Harry Potter”-themed wedding,’ and I think, ‘Gosh, what’s their first night of fun going to be?’ I can’t even think about it.
